To understand why Malamaal Weekly remains in such high demand on download portals, one must look at its script. Set in the rustic, drought-stricken village of Laholi, the film creates a premise so absurd yet so grounded that it hooks the viewer instantly.
The story kicks off when Lilaram (Paresh Rawal), a struggling lottery ticket seller, discovers that one of his customers—a local drunkard named Anthony—has won the ₹1 crore jackpot. The catch? Anthony dies of shock upon seeing the winning numbers. What follows is a slapstick masterclass in greed, desperation, and cover-ups.
The narrative transforms into a frantic attempt by Lilaram and the local milkman, Ballu (Om Puri), to claim the prize money while hiding Anthony’s body. The film’s brilliance lies in its escalation; every time they try to fix the problem, it spirals further out of control, involving Ballu’s wife, a suspicious district collector, and eventually, a police inspector. It is a remake of the Irish film Waking Ned Devine, but Priyadarshan Indianizes the narrative so effectively that it feels indigenous to the soil of rural India.

“Malamaal Weekly” (2006), directed by Priyadarshan and adapted from the British film “Waking Ned” (1998), is a small-town Hindi comedy that blends farce with social commentary. The film’s plot—about a lottery-winning villager, the ensuing complications when he dies, and the townspeople’s scramble to claim the prize—uses humor to probe poverty, community dynamics, and moral compromise.
